Añadir al carritoPaperback. Condición: New. Print on Demand. This guide on principles of ornamental design is an exhaustive manual drawn from the writings and lectures of design authorities. The author explores the sources of style, discussing its important elements, and examines how ornament is applied in architecture, furniture, and other objects. The chapters also cover the history of design, going back to early civilizations and exploring the evolution of decorative forms. The author's insights reflect a Victorian fascination with nature and its application in ornament. The book makes clear that decorative art must be subservient to the purpose of the design and must have regard to construction and utility, prior to the consideration of its ornamental decoration.
